What is the y-interecept of the line y-14=6(x-2.5)

Respuesta :

goddessboi goddessboi
  • 03-12-2021

Answer:

Y-intercept = -1

Step-by-step explanation:

Convert to slope-intercept form:

y-14 = 6(x-2.5)

y-14 = 6x-15

y = 6x-1

Therefore, the y-intercept is -1
